			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>A report published by market analyst Ovum have shown that the IT market is expected to see growth of over 4.4% in the next four years, that is very good news for IT contactors.<br />
The market is predicted to return to pre-recession levels of growth by 2013, which will offer much more possibilities for contractors getting work done in the IT services industry.<br />
The report does on the other hand warn that “the market is not out of the woods yet and there will be small regional and segmental dips along the way”.<br />
